Answer: The angles of ΔA'B'C are congruent to the corresponding parts of the original triangle.
Step-by-step explanation:
Given : Triangle ABC was rotated 90 degrees clockwise. Then it underwent a dilation centered at the origin with a scale factor of 4.
A rotation is a rigid transformation that creates congruent images but dilation is not a rigid transformation, it creates similar images but not congruent.
Also, the corresponding angles of similar triangles are congruent.
Therefore, The angles of ΔA'B'C are congruent to the corresponding parts of the original triangle.
